Here are a few rules that will keep your teenager safer...

1) Ensure they never drive with only fellow teens as passengers.

2) It's important for your teen's safety that he/she does not drive in the night. And, where it becomes inevitable, go over things they must bear in mind.

Those who drive in the night (between 9.00pm and 2.00am) run a bigger risk of having accidents.

3) Let them know the dangers of driving after drinking and have them promise never to drive after drinking. For their safety they should not touch the steering wheels even if all they took was just a sip.

4) Let it be ingrained in your teenager that they are not on a race track even when they are on the highway.

Make sure they are grounded if they ever get a speeding ticket.

5) Encourage your teen to tell you wherever they want to drive to and know in whose company it will be if any. It may be hard sometimes but there are place where your teen is better off using public transport.
